I found this book at Wal-Mart, flipped through it and decided this would be my first book to read.
The authors are Heidi Murkoff, Arlene Eisenberg, and Sandee Hathaway. It is a fairly thick book but very knowledgable. The book starts with the very beginning of pregnancy. Listing signs and symptoms to help you determine if you are indeed pregnant. It breaks the chapters down by each month of pregnancy also listed how many weeks pregnant you are. This is important to know because the doctors look at the pregnancy in terms of weeks rather than months. Each chapter explains what you can expect at the doctors visit for that month as well as what you maybe experiencing in the pregnancy. More than likely if you are experiencing something common or not so common you can find it in this book. If it is way out of the ordinary you may not find any information on the particular issue in this book. After the book goes through the pregnancy months there are additional interesting chapters. One is on labor and delivery. Another is on the first six weeks postpartum. There is actually a chapter for the fathers to read. There is also a chapter on some of the complications and problems that can occur during pregnancy. At the end of the book there is a page for each month so you can take notes. I would recommend this book to any expecting mother.
